aboutsummaryrefslogtreecommitdiff
path: root/handlers/gen.py
diff options
context:
space:
mode:
authorIgor Tolmachov <me@igorek.dev>2022-12-03 18:20:16 +0900
committerIgor Tolmachov <me@igorek.dev>2022-12-03 18:20:16 +0900
commit0d5cab62b0d077ad7946b64a534e3914f1cc79dd (patch)
treee2bd44b832d29312d05cf736f691ba5b87e611c3 /handlers/gen.py
parentd717c4e08245196b0d528716f9d269c71749365a (diff)
downloadkarpov_ai_bot-0d5cab62b0d077ad7946b64a534e3914f1cc79dd.tar.gz
karpov_ai_bot-0d5cab62b0d077ad7946b64a534e3914f1cc79dd.zip
2.0
Diffstat (limited to 'handlers/gen.py')
-rw-r--r--handlers/gen.py14
1 files changed, 7 insertions, 7 deletions
diff --git a/handlers/gen.py b/handlers/gen.py
index e4398bd..72afb79 100644
--- a/handlers/gen.py
+++ b/handlers/gen.py
@@ -39,10 +39,9 @@ def get_text(chat_id: int) -> str:
39 39
40@dp.message_handler(commands=["gen"]) 40@dp.message_handler(commands=["gen"])
41async def gen_command(msg: t.Message) -> None: 41async def gen_command(msg: t.Message) -> None:
42 await msg.delete() 42 if config.get_config(msg.chat.id).gen.delete_command:
43 message = get_text(msg.chat.id) 43 await msg.delete()
44 if message is not None: 44 await msg.answer(get_text(msg.chat.id))
45 await msg.answer(message)
46 45
47 46
48@dp.message_handler(commands=["del"]) 47@dp.message_handler(commands=["del"])
@@ -64,6 +63,7 @@ async def del_command(msg: t.Message) -> None:
64 content_types=[t.ContentType.ANY], 63 content_types=[t.ContentType.ANY],
65) 64)
66async def chance_message(msg: t.Message) -> None: 65async def chance_message(msg: t.Message) -> None:
67 message = get_text(msg.chat.id) 66 if config.get_config(msg.chat.id).gen.reply:
68 if message is not None: 67 await msg.reply(get_text(msg.chat.id))
69 await msg.reply(message) 68 else:
69 await msg.answer(get_text(msg.chat.id))